Bruin Report Online’s Tracy Pierson spoke with UCLA head coach Jim Mora in the coach’s office about variety of topics, including the upcoming Under Armour contract, the impact of the new Wasserman Football Center and the revamped coaching staff.
He reaffirmed that given the opportunity, he “never wants to leave” UCLA. He had similar comments in January when he spoke to the media soon after hiring offensive coordinator Jedd Fisch.
Mora also accepted “all the blame” for last year’s offensive failure, saying that he “miscalculated,” especially how the scheme fit the personnel. He added that he did a “poor job” of executing the vision he had for the offense.
